Output 6d3d1bd5421053cadef2fe8e03c2ad6c05efab0d43f50f82e23fe82788dd31a7:4

value
6604951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8673f5bb6dd1d4299f0058b368671689b48697b5 OP_EQUAL
address
3DwwPHQ1ej8QrxZkubVo1e5DXWrhXkVs1x
transaction
6d3d1bd5421053cadef2fe8e03c2ad6c05efab0d43f50f82e23fe82788dd31a7
spent
true